HUMAN-IMMUNODEFICIENCY-VIRUS TYPE-1 GAG-POL FRAMESHIFTING IS DEPENDENT ON DOWNSTREAM MESSENGER-RNA SECONDARY STRUCTURE - DEMONSTRATION BY EXPRESSION INVIVO

The human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1) Gag-Pol fusion polyprotein is produced via ribosomal frameshifting. Previous studies in vitro and in Saccharomyces cerevisiae have argued against a significant role for RNA secondary structure 3' of the shift site, in contrast with other systems, in which such structure has been shown to be required. Here we show, by expressing the HIV-1 gag-pol domain in cultured vertebrate cells, that a stem-loop structure 3' of the HIV-1 shift site is indeed important for wild-type levels of frameshifting in vivo.
